Output 376e6253903ef0851eb5ff4cc78f8c0276984fd0a902f76a408d7418771bfa42:2

value
66355063
script pubkey
OP_0 OP_PUSHBYTES_20 5e72e8a3a87b423722fb2d4b072a70d366e9126f
address
ltc1qteew3gag0dprwghm949sw2ns6dnwjyn0earutd
transaction
376e6253903ef0851eb5ff4cc78f8c0276984fd0a902f76a408d7418771bfa42
spent
true